In The Belly of a Laughing God: Humour and Irony in Native Women's Poetry Children's - Fiction Myna IshulutakIn the Belly of a Laughing God: Humour and Irony in Native Women's Poetry by Jennifer Andrews, professor in the Department of English at the University of New Brunswick, offers critical analysis of the works of eight cotemporary women poets.
